Hello All,

I've recently picked up my first AR-15 rifle...it is a S&W M&P 15R in 5.45x39.  The gun is great and I'd now like to get a new caliber, but don't know exactly what all I need.

Will I be ok if I buy a complete upper, or do I need buy other stuff too?

Also, if it matters, i'd like to eventually get 223 and 450bushmaster, or 50 beowulf

You should be able to pick up a complete upper as you noted. BUT read what it comes with - sights ? flat top or A2 reciver, type gas block - flay , A2 or with rail, type handguard free float vs standard , M4 feed ramps or not etc. Make sure the upper you order has the pin size your lower has, most are small but Colt had over sized and some guns had small rear and larger front. Some suppliers have non Colt uppers to fit Colt lowers , no big deal just check . MOD 1 , Bravo, M & A and a hundred others have adds that can help see the differences. Shop for price and quality as it can vary. Also I like to stick with Military spec. parts as they should fit togather well.
